Common use

Ultravate is used to relieve inflammation, redness, itching, and discomfort caused by skin conditions such as psoriasis, atopic dermatitis, and other corticosteroid-responsive dermatoses. It works by suppressing the immune response in the affected skin area.

Dosage and direction

Apply a thin layer of Ultravate to the affected area once or twice daily, as directed by your healthcare provider. Use only on intact skin and avoid covering the treated area with bandages unless instructed. Do not apply on the face, groin, or underarms unless specifically prescribed.

Precautions

Avoid long-term use, especially on large skin areas, as it may increase the risk of systemic absorption. Inform your doctor if you have a history of skin infections, diabetes, immune disorders, or if you are pregnant or breastfeeding. Avoid contact with eyes and mucous membranes.

Contraindications

Do not use Ultravate if you are allergic to halobetasol or other corticosteroids. It is contraindicated on infected, ulcerated, or severely damaged skin, as well as in patients with rosacea or acne.

Possible side effect

Common side effects include burning, dryness, irritation, itching, or redness at the application site. Long-term use may lead to skin thinning, stretch marks, discoloration, and hormonal effects. Rare but serious effects include adrenal suppression or worsening of untreated infections.

Drug interaction

Since Ultravate is used topically, systemic interactions are rare. However, using other corticosteroid products may increase the risk of side effects. Inform your doctor about all topical or systemic medications you are using.

Missed dose

If you miss a dose, apply it as soon as you remember. If it is almost time for the next application, skip the missed dose. Do not apply extra amounts to make up for the missed dose.

Overdose

Excessive or prolonged use can cause systemic corticosteroid effects such as adrenal suppression, weight gain, or skin thinning. Seek medical advice if you suspect overuse.

Storage

Store Ultravate at room temperature, away from heat, moisture, and direct sunlight. Keep the tube or bottle tightly closed and out of reach of children.
